      Some additional thoughts on the alternates now that I've played more. One thing that took me a long time to discover is that the alternate Boromir, Legolas, and Gimli don't trigger Worn With Sorrow and Toil if they're using their Guide ability to separate. Since that card has often been a big pain for me, it's nice to not have to worry about it as much. Also, with Dunadan as guide, I'm less afraid to take him as a casualty for 3-tile. Normally I'd be inclined to keep Strider for his hiding ability, but if I've chosen Dunadan, the decision is relatively easy if a 3 is drawn. @@rompsteelwarofthering6490
